Is it possible to run a persisten disk image from hd using a boot loader? What i mean is that i've created a usb bootable version of knoppix with persistent disk image (knoppix-data.img) and made a lot of chages there. Now is it possible to copy this (boot and KNOPPIX folders) to some partition on my computer and run it through grub or lilo without putting in the usb stick?
If not is it possible to use the stick to boot and then redirect to the hd copy, so that the usb stick could be unmounted with knoppix still running?
